Khulna journo put on 3-day remand

Khulna: A court here on Wednesday placed Hedait Hossain Mollah, Khulna correspondent of Dhaka Tribune and online portal Bangla Tribune, on 3-day remand in a case filed under the Digital Security Act for running reports on election results of Khunla-1 constituency with ‘false’ information.

Judge Nayan Biswas of Khulna Judicial Magistrate court-3 passed the order after officer-in-charge of Batiaghata Police Station Mahbubur Rahman, also investigation officer of the case, produced him before the court seeking a seven-day remand, reports the UNB.

Upazila Nirbahi Officer and Assistant Returning Officer Debashish Chowdhury filed the case with his police station on Monday night against Hedait, also the city editor of local newspaper Dainik Probaho, and Rashedul Islam, Khulna Bureau Chief of the Dainik Manabzamin and newly elected vice-president of Khulna Press Club.

Plainclothes police picked up Hedait from Gallamari area in the city around 2:15 pm on Tuesday.

Later, a court sent him to jail.

According to the case statement, Bangla Tribune and Manabzamin published reports headlined ’22,419 more than total votes cast in Khulna-1’ based on false and fabricated information.
